Flight Advisory (GPS Interference Testing
FLIGHT ADVISORY GPS INTERFERENCE TESTING GULF AREA FREQUENCY COORDINATOR FLORIDA (GAFCFL) 25-02 17 April Pensacola Beach, FL The entire flight advisory may be accessed and downloaded at the following address: https://www.faasafety.gov/files/notices/2025/Apr/GAFCFL_25-02_GPS_Flight_Advisory.pdf Pilots are advised to check NOTAMs frequently for possible changes prior to operations in the area. NOTAMs will be published at least 24 hours in advance of this event.
